When Bark Psychosis went into temporary abeyance after Hex as Graham Sutton concentrated on work as Boymerang, their old label 3rd Stone decided to do another compilation in 1997 – very confusingly partially replicating Independency but replacing some of its tracks with other offerings. It adds some rarities, such as the unreleased “Murder City,” the standalone “Blue” single, an early live “Pendulum Man,” and their low-key, bemusing cover of “Three Girl Rhumba” for a Wire tribute album, but it makes for a strangely duplicative effort all around.
